Dynamic tension sensorOverview
The JZL200-D digital force sensor adopts a low-power CPU processor, a 24 bit high-precision AD converter, and long-distance communication technology, which has low power consumption, high measurement accuracy, long transmission distance, and stable performance. The sensor probe adopts a stainless steel sealed structure with a small volume. Connect to the computer via USB interface and display and store the force curve on the sensor acquisition software. Data storage supports TXT text file format and EXCELL format file export.
technical indicators
| Indicator project | parameter |
| Measurement range | 0-100KN optional |
| Nonlinear | 0.2% • FS @ room temperature |
| Frequency response | >100Hz |
| Overload capacity | 150% |
| Temperature drift | ≤±0.01%F·S/℃ |
| Data output rate | 1000Hz~1pm/30min adjustable in multiple levels |
| Interface | USB |
| Communication bus | RS485 |
| Working temperature range | -40~65℃ |
Dynamic tension sensorPrecautions
1. The tension sensor should be handled with care, especially for small capacity sensors that use alloy aluminum materials as elastic bodies. Any impact or drop caused by vibration is likely to cause significant output errors.
2. When designing and installing the loading device, it should be ensured that the line of action of the loading force coincides with the axis of the tension sensor, so as to minimize the influence of tilting load and eccentric load.
3. In terms of horizontal adjustment. If a single tension sensor is used, the installation plane of its base should be adjusted using a spirit level until it is level; If multiple sensors are measuring simultaneously, the mounting surfaces of their bases should be kept as horizontal as possible to ensure that the force borne by each sensor is basically the same.
4. The mounting surface of the sensor base should be as flat and clean as possible, without any oil stains or adhesive film. The installation base itself should have sufficient strength and rigidity, usually requiring higher strength and rigidity than the sensor itself.
5. To prevent chemical corrosion, it is advisable to apply Vaseline to the outer surface of the tension sensor during installation. The use of the platform should avoid direct sunlight and sudden changes in environmental temperature.
